Tooth decay and trauma lead to damaged teeth, and damaged teeth require professional dental care. Restorative dentistry aims to restore a damaged tooth’s shape, strength, size, and appearance. In many cases, a dental crown is recommended to cover the damaged tooth.

REASONS FOR A DENTAL CROWN

Patients often need a dental crown for one of these reasons: 

  • To protect a weak or worn down tooth from breaking
  • To keep a cracked tooth together
  • To support a tooth with a large filling
  • To hold a dental bridge in place
  • To cover a misshapen or discolored tooth
  • To cover a dental implant
  • To cover a root canaled tooth

DENTAL CROWN PLACEMENT

Dental crown placement typically takes two appointments. 

During the first appointment, Dr. Levi will prepare your tooth for the crown. This requires removing some of the dental enamel and shaping the tooth so the crown can fit over it without appearing bulky or misshapen. Then, she will take an impression of your tooth and the surrounding teeth and gums. The impressions are sent to a dental laboratory where the lab technicians will create your customized dental crown. Before leaving your first appointment, Dr. Levi will cover your natural tooth with a temporary crown. 

When the permanent crown arrives at our office, you will come in for your second visit. Dr. Levi will remove the temporary crown and cement the permanent crown into place, making sure it looks and feels natural. 

HOW TO CARE FOR YOUR DENTAL CROWN

When taken proper care of, your crown can last more than a decade. Be sure to practice good oral hygiene, like brushing twice a day and flossing daily, eating properly, and visiting the dentist at least twice a year. 

To avoid damaging your dental crown, stay away from these bad habits: 

  • Biting your nails
  • Chewing ice
  • Grinding your teeth
